casestatus.in Summary

The Supreme Court heard the Special Leave Petition filed by Ratiram Majhwar & another against the High Court of Chhattisgarh's order dated 28-04-2025. The Court condoned the delay in filing and dismissed the petition, finding no grounds for interference with the impugned High Court order. All pending applications were disposed of accordingly.
